BabelDOC:颠覆传统PDF翻译的智能解决方案
【免费下载链接】BabelDOCYet Another Document Translator项目地址: https://gitcode.com/GitHub_Trending/ba/BabelDOC
还在为技术文档的语言障碍而烦恼吗?当面对满是专业术语和复杂公式的外文PDF时,你是否曾感到无从下手?BabelDOC的出现,将彻底改变这一现状。这款基于Python的智能翻译工具,不仅能够准确转换文档内容,更能在保持原始格式的基础上,实现高质量的跨语言沟通。
为什么你的PDF翻译总是不尽如人意?
传统翻译工具在处理技术文档时往往面临三大痛点:格式混乱、术语不准、公式错位。想象一下,一份精心排版的学术论文经过翻译后变得面目全非,关键的技术细节丢失殆尽,这样的翻译结果怎能让人满意?
BabelDOC通过创新的中间语言架构,将文档解析与翻译过程巧妙分离。这种设计理念确保了格式还原的精确性,同时提升了翻译质量。无论你是研究人员、工程师还是学生,都能从中受益。
BabelDOC智能翻译效果:复杂公式与专业术语的完美转换
三步开启智能翻译新时代
环境准备简单快捷:
- 获取项目源码:
git clone https://gitcode.com/GitHub_Trending/ba/BabelDOC - 安装uv包管理器(支持多平台)
- 部署项目依赖:
uv tool install --python 3.12 BabelDOC
系统配置参考表
| 配置项目 | 最低要求 | 推荐配置 |
|---|---|---|
| Python版本 | 3.10及以上 | 3.12 |
| 内存容量 | 4GB | 8GB或更高 |
| 存储空间 | 100MB | 500MB以上 |
核心功能深度解析
精准格式保留技术
BabelDOC最大的亮点在于其出色的格式还原能力。通过深度解析PDF文档结构,工具能够识别并保留原始文档中的排版细节、字体样式和页面布局。这意味着翻译后的文档不仅内容准确,视觉效果也几乎与原版无异。
智能术语处理引擎
内置的专业术语库支持自定义导入,确保技术术语的翻译既准确又符合行业规范。你可以通过示例术语表来配置个性化的翻译策略。
并行处理加速机制
借助异步处理技术,BabelDOC能够同时处理多个翻译任务,显著提升工作效率。在启用并行模式后,处理速度可提升30%-50%,具体表现取决于硬件配置。
实用操作技巧分享
新手入门建议
初次使用建议从简单的单页文档开始,逐步熟悉工具的各项功能。可以先尝试翻译技术规格书或产品说明书这类结构相对简单的文档。
批量处理高效方案
面对大量PDF文件需要翻译的情况,可以利用通配符批量操作功能。这不仅节省了重复操作的时间,还能确保所有文档的翻译风格保持一致。
双语对照阅读模式
启用双语模式后,原文与译文并排显示,便于对比验证。这种模式特别适合需要精确核对的专业文档翻译,能有效提升工作效率。
技术实现亮点揭秘
想要深入了解BabelDOC背后的技术原理?项目的技术实现文档详细介绍了异步翻译、段落识别和排版算法等关键模块的实现细节。
创新架构设计
BabelDOC采用模块化设计,各个功能模块相互独立又紧密协作。从文档解析到最终输出,每个环节都经过精心优化。
常见问题解决方案
翻译质量如何保证?工具内置了多重质量检测机制,包括术语一致性检查、格式完整性验证等。同时支持人工校对接口,确保最终输出的准确性。
如何处理特殊格式文档?对于包含复杂表格、数学公式或特殊符号的文档,BabelDOC提供了专门的解析算法,确保这些特殊元素的准确转换。
未来发展方向展望
BabelDOC团队持续致力于提升工具的智能化水平。未来版本将引入更多AI技术,进一步优化翻译质量和用户体验。
无论你是需要处理单个文档的个人用户,还是需要批量翻译技术资料的企业用户,BabelDOC都能提供专业、可靠的解决方案。现在就开始体验,让PDF翻译不再成为技术交流的障碍!
【免费下载链接】BabelDOCYet Another Document Translator项目地址: https://gitcode.com/GitHub_Trending/ba/BabelDOC
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考